Ticket: Nightly search reindex stalls at 82% on the Pellago catalog cluster. Customers report stale results for items added after midnight. The reindex worker retries shard 14 repeatedly before timing out; no data loss observed, only staleness. Workaround: trigger a manual partial reindex via the admin console. Support should reference the failing job by the trace token recorded below.

session token of yahof-bajeg = htk9_0d43d44ed

## Introduce per-tenant rate quotas in the Orvane gateway

For the release manager: this change replaces our global throttle with per-tenant quotas, resolved at request time from the tenant registry and cached for sixty seconds. Tenants without an explicit quota inherit the tier default; overage returns a retryable status with a hint header. Rollout is gated behind a flag, defaulting off, and the old throttle remains as a backstop until two clean release cycles pass.

The initial tier defaults we intend to ship are listed below.

limits module of taguf-hafog:
WEIGHTS = {
    "wenox": 690,
    "wenok": 782,
    "kelax": 41,
    "holox": 338,
    "quenir": 39,
}

The sweeper runs nightly and reclaims resources with no owning deployment: dangling volumes, unattached load balancers, and expired preview environments. Candidates are quarantined for 72 hours before deletion, so accidental reclaims are recoverable. As on-call, you mainly care about two alerts: quarantine backlog growth and sweep-job failure. Both are safe to snooze once during business hours; page the Fabric team otherwise. The triage steps and quarantine restore procedure are documented on the internal page below.

dashboard of yafog-fajof = https://jira.tolvaqsys.internal/pages/pages/projects/49fe21c4

// Fixture: tiered ticket-pricing experiment (Fennwick Arena rollout).
// Covers variants A/B/C of the Skylark dynamic-pricing engine.
// Variant B intentionally returns a negative discount to test clamping.
// Do not edit seat maps by hand; regenerate via the Mallow script.
// Support: if a customer reports wrong prices, check which variant
// bucket their session landed in before escalating.
// Fetching live experiment config requires the bearer token below.

session JWT of yawep-yawep = eyJhbGciOiJIUzI1NiIsInR5cCI6IkpXVCJ9.eyJzdWIiOiI3pWF3_In0.aXYsHiog